Preparing for Hurricane Milton in Brevard County

People in Brevard County were busy preparing for Hurricane Milton, which is expected to make landfall over Florida as a major hurricane, possible a Category 3. On Monday, it became a Category 5 hurricane with sustained winds of 180 mph.

Floridians fill sandbags ahead of Tropical Storm Milton

Sandbag locations have opened up around Central Florida ahead of Tropical Storm Milton. FOX 35's Matt Trezza was in Altamonte Springs, Florida, on Saturday morning where residents were filling sandbags. Milton is expected to strengthen into a hurricane before making landfall this week, potentially on Wednesday.
